Shirtadi Coastal Friends celebrate Tenth Anniversary

Shirtadi Coastal Friends celebrate Tenth Anniversary
Photo Credit : News Karnataka

Moodabidri: The youth are getting away from our culture. We are destroying our culture by giving mobile phones to children. If anything remains of Tulunad culture today, it is from the women of the village. Kemaru Isha Vithaladasa Swamiji said that the youth should not surrender to the western culture but should preserve and develop our culture.

He blessed the 10th anniversary ceremony of Coastal Friends of Shirtadi.

MLA Umanatha Kotyan, KPCC Secretary Mithun Rai, and former APMC President Praveen Kumar participated in the meeting presided over by Shirtadi Gramm President Santosh Kotyan.

Lewis Saldanha, Srikanth Borugudde, Journalist Ashraf Valpadi, Kumari Pooja Shirtadi of Yakshagana Constituency, Ranjith of Amma Sounds in Industry, Ganesh Aliyur of Drama and Sridhara Pujari Shirtadi and Suresh Pujari, Mangila were honored in Kambala Constituency. Sandeep Salyan, convener of Karavali Friends, was felicitated by Friends Circle.

Coastal Friends Founder Sandeep Salyan Committee Chairman Vijay Salyan, Secretary Gopal Gundappu, Vice President Satish KC, Secretary Prashant Valpadi, Treasurer Lohit Sanil, Members Ganesh Borugudde, Nitish Konaje, Rajesh Montradi, Satish Daddalpalke, Sudhakar Daregudde, Nivesh Konaje, Suchendrana Koje, Nagesh Borugudde, Rohit Pacchanadi, Vivek Valpadi, Ranjit Savya, Ashok Kaze, Prasad Borugudde and others were present on this occasion.

Gurkare Yakshagana was performed by Hiriyadka Mela.
